Definition: FORKED COUNSEL

Part of Speech Definition
Expression 1. Advice pointing more than one way; ambiguous advice. [Obs.] --B. Jonson. -- Fork"ed*ly , adv. -- Fork"ed*ness , n.[Websters].

Source: Webster's Revised Unabridged Dictionary (1913)
